What is a Ranch CFO?

A Ranch CFO, or Chief Financial Officer, is a senior executive responsible for managing the financial activities of a ranching operation. Their duties include overseeing budgets, financial planning, accounting, risk management, and sometimes human resources for the ranch. The Ranch CFO analyzes financial data to guide business decisions, ensure profitability, and help the ranch achieve its long-term goals. They also ensure compliance with tax laws and financial regulations specific to agriculture and ranching.

What is the difference between Ranch CFO vs Ranch Accountant?

AspectRanch CFORanch Accountant
CredentialsTypically requires a bachelor's degree in finance, accounting, or related field; often CPA or CFA certificationsRequires a bachelor's degree in accounting or finance; CPA certification preferred
Work EnvironmentStrategic financial planning, overseeing budgets, and high-level decision makingManaging day-to-day bookkeeping, financial record keeping, and reporting
Employer & Industry UsageUsed in large ranch operations, agribusiness firms, and corporate ranch managementCommon in smaller ranches, farms, and local agricultural businesses

The Ranch CFO focuses on strategic financial management, planning, and overseeing financial operations at a high level. In contrast, the Ranch Accountant handles routine bookkeeping, financial record keeping, and reporting. Both roles require strong financial credentials, but the CFO's responsibilities are broader and more strategic, often in larger or corporate ranch settings.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Ranch CFO,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Ranch CFO, you need a solid background in accounting, financial planning, and agribusiness management, often supported by a degree in finance or accounting and relevant certifications such as CPA. Familiarity with ranch management software, ERP systems, and advanced Excel skills is typically required to manage budgets, payroll, and operational costs. Strong analytical thinking, leadership, and effective communication set top candidates apart in this role. These skills are crucial for ensuring the ranch's financial health, optimizing resource allocation, and supporting sustainable business growth.

How does a Ranch CFO typically collaborate with ranch operations and management teams to ensure financial targets are met?

A Ranch CFO works closely with ranch operations and management teams by regularly reviewing budgets, analyzing operational costs, and providing financial forecasts that inform decision-making. They often participate in strategic planning meetings, help prioritize resource allocation, and ensure compliance with both agricultural regulations and financial best practices. Effective communication and a proactive approach to problem-solving are essential, as the CFO must translate financial insights into practical recommendations for ranch managers and staff. This collaboration helps align financial goals with operational realities, supporting the ranch's long-term sustainability and profitability.
